BaSr₂P₂O₈ is a barium strontium phosphate ceramic belonging to the family of rare-earth-free phosphate compounds. This material is primarily investigated for photoluminescent and optical applications, where its crystal structure enables efficient light emission and energy conversion under ultraviolet or electron excitation. It represents a research-focused compound rather than a commodity ceramic, valued for its potential in display technologies, lighting systems, and radiation detection where alternatives like rare-earth-doped phosphors may be cost-prohibitive or functionally limited.
